What Is a Crash Rated Fence?

a 15,000 pound truck crashing into a security fence

Also known as anti-ram fencing, these structures are specifically engineered to prevent vehicles from breaching the perimeter of a secure area. They are commonly used in environments where there is a risk of vehicular attacks or unauthorized access. Anti-ram fences are essential for government facilities, commercial properties, and other high-risk areas that require strong physical barriers to ensure safety.

Crash Fence Ratings Explained

High-security fences are often evaluated using a rating system that indicates how much force they can withstand. Initially, the Department of State introduced the K rating system, which was based on a vehicle weighing 15,000 pounds traveling at different speeds. For example:

  • K4 rating: Stops a 15,000-pound vehicle at 30 mph.
  • K8 rating: Stops a 15,000-pound vehicle at 40 mph.
  • K12 rating: Stops a 15,000-pound vehicle at 50 mph.

These ratings have since evolved with the ASTM standards, introducing M ratings for medium-duty trucks. The M ratings follow a similar structure but include a P rating that measures how far the vehicle can travel past the barrier after impact:

  • M30: Stops a 15,000-pound vehicle at 30 mph.
  • M40: Stops a 15,000-pound vehicle at 40 mph.
  • M50: Stops a 15,000-pound vehicle at 50 mph.

The P ratings range from P1 to P4, with P1 being the most restrictive, allowing only up to 1 meter (3.3 feet) beyond the barrier, while P4 allows more than 30 meters (98.4 feet).

While the K ratings are no longer officially used, they are still referenced alongside the updated M ratings. Understanding these ratings is crucial when selecting the right type of fence for your facility.

Common Uses for High-Security Fencing Systems

Crash-rated fences are ideal for businesses that require top-tier security. These include government buildings, military installations, courthouses, and other sensitive locations. In the commercial sector, they are also used in chemical plants, banks, power plants, airports, and data centers.

Essentially, any facility that needs a strong perimeter defense—whether due to potential threats or the presence of sensitive information—benefits from crash-rated fencing. These systems are not just about preventing breaches; they also provide peace of mind for business owners and staff.

Crash Rated Fences With Crash Rated Gates

A crash-rated gate complements a crash-rated fence by providing additional security at entry points. These gates are designed to withstand impacts from vehicles, just like the fence itself. Choosing a gate that matches the rating of your fence ensures consistent protection across your entire perimeter.

Not all security fences are crash-rated. A crash-rated fence has passed rigorous testing and received an official ASTM rating, whereas a crash-tested fence may not have met the required standards. It's important to verify that the fence you choose has been certified to ensure it provides the intended level of protection.

How Much Do Crash Rated Fences Cost?

The cost of a crash-rated fence depends on several factors, including the size of the installation, the materials used, and the level of customization required. While the initial purchase price is an important consideration, it's also essential to factor in installation costs, labor, and any additional hardware needed for the system.

Customization adds to the overall cost, as it involves design, manufacturing, and installation. However, investing in a high-quality, crash-rated fence is a long-term decision that offers significant value in terms of security and peace of mind. Regular maintenance is also recommended to ensure the fence continues to perform effectively over time.
